It was just last week when a North Tonawanda man was struck and killed while riding his bicycle trying to cross Twin Cities Highway (Route 425) at Schenck Street.  Tragically he was trying to cross the heavily traveled highway against the traffic light.  Neither driver was charged.

It's a sad pattern of recent pedestrian and bicyclist deaths in the area and in each case the victim failed to observe basic travel rules.  Each of those victims left behind broken-hearted family and friends, not to mention the drivers who are left with nightmares.

Since that accident a poignant memorial to 34-year old Aaron Hoellig appeared along the Twin Cities Highway just a few feet away from where he was killed.  Aaron was a musician who played in a number of local bands, he loved to read and served in the US Army National Guard.
